The following players have been invited to play for Wales against England in the first international of the season on the Liverpool F.C. ground on Saturday: –
Cyril Sidlow (Wolverhampton); Wally Barnes (Arsenal), Ray Lambert (Liverpool); Don Dearson (Birmingham), Billy Hughes (Birmingham), Ron Burgess (Tottenham); Ehud Rogers (Swansea), Lee Jones (Arsenal), George Lowrie (Coventry), Billy Lucas (Swindon), Horace Cumner (Arsenal).
The Welsh team shows one change from the side which drew 1-1 with R.A.F. at Wrexham a fortnight ago, Cliff Edwards (West Bromwich) being replaced by Rogers, who appeared for Wales against England at Ninian Park in June, 1941. There are no new caps in the side.
